DECISION
OF THE MINISTER OF FINANCE NO. 297/1998/QD-BTC
DATED MARCH 16, 1998 ON THE ISSUANCE AND PRINTING,
MANAGEMENT AND USE OF IMPORT STAMPS
THE MINISTER OF FINANCE
Pursuant to the Accounting and Statistics Ordinance dated May 20, 1988;
Pursuant to Decree No. 15/CP dated March 2, 1993 of the Government on tasks, powers, and responsibilities for state management by ministries and ministerial-level agencies;
Pursuant to Decree No. 178/CP dated October 28, 1994 of the Government stipulating functions, tasks, and organizational structure of the Ministry of Finance;
To implement Directive No. 853/1997/CT-TTg dated October 11, 1997 of the Prime Minister on combating smuggling in new circumstances;
Pursuant to Circular No. 311/VPCP-VI dated January 24, 1998 of the Government Office conveying instructions from the Prime Minister regarding affixing import stamps;
After consultation with the Ministry of Trade, the Ministry of Home Affairs, and the General Customs Department;
DECISION
Article 1.- To promulgate together with this Decision "Regulations on the issuance, printing, management, and use of import stamps for electronic goods, refrigerated goods, internal combustion engines, and construction materials."
Article 2.- The types of import stamps issued pursuant to this Decision shall take effect from April 1, 1998.
Article 3.- Organizations involved in the printing, issuance, management, and use of import stamps as stipulated in Article 1 are responsible for implementing this Decision.
